What are Neurotoxins?

Neurotoxins are a type of protein derived from botulinum toxin. They are used in cosmetic procedures to temporarily paralyze or relax muscles, effectively reducing wrinkles caused by facial expressions. The most common neurotoxins used for these therapies are Botox, Dysport, and Xeomin. Neurotoxins block the signals sent from the nerves to the muscles, which causes temporary paralysis or relaxation of the muscles. The effects of neurotoxins typically last for several months before a repeat treatment is necessary.


Botox: Unraveling Its Features and Benefits

Botox, a well-known neurotoxin, has become a primary solution in the cosmetic treatment landscape. Botox is renowned for its efficacy in minimizing dynamic wrinkles and fine lines because it blocks nerve signals responsible for muscle contractions. This action results in smoother skin and reduced signs of aging, making it a popular choice for individuals seeking non-invasive methods to rejuvenate their appearance.


Key Benefits of Botox

With a robust and well-documented track record, Botox excels in treating various areas such as crow's feet, forehead, and frown lines. It consistently delivers predictable and reliable results, making it a go-to choice for individuals looking to address specific facial areas and achieve a refreshed, youthful look. The distinct formulation of Botox and its precision in targeting specific muscles contribute to its success in the aesthetic industry.

Dysport: Exploring Its Unique Characteristics

Dysport, a botulinum toxin type A similar to Botox, presents distinctive properties and benefits within neurotoxin treatments. Recognized for its effectiveness in reducing wrinkles and fine lines, Dysport offers a different approach due to its formulation and diffusion properties.


Advantages of Dysport

Dysport distinguishes itself with a quicker onset of action than its counterparts, potentially yielding faster visible results for individuals seeking immediate improvements. Its ability to diffuse more extensively makes it optimal for treating larger areas, particularly beneficial for forehead lines and other expansive facial regions. This wider spread may also require fewer injections, enhancing the treatment experience for some individuals seeking cosmetic enhancements. Dysport's unique characteristics make it a noteworthy alternative within the landscape of injectable treatments for those desiring a different approach or quicker results.

Xeomin: Unveiling Its Attributes and Advantages

Xeomin, a botulinum toxin type A, stands out due to its unique formulation and specific advantages in the neurotoxin approach. Known for its pure composition and efficacy in reducing facial lines, Xeomin offers a distinct approach to addressing wrinkles and fine lines.


Distinctive Features of Xeomin

Xeomin's formulation, devoid of complexing proteins found in other neurotoxins like Botox and Dysport, makes it an optimal choice for individuals sensitive to additives or prone to allergic reactions. Its pure nature decreases the likelihood of developing antibodies, which might occur with more complex formulations. This feature makes Xeomin a compelling option for individuals seeking the benefits of a neurotoxin treatment while aiming to minimize the risk of adverse reactions. Furthermore, Xeomin effectively addresses facial lines without altering natural facial expressions, catering to those who seek subtle enhancements without compromising their natural appearance.

Factors Influencing the Choice

Several crucial factors come into play when choosing the most suitable neurotoxin treatment:

Treatment Areas Customization

Understanding the different properties and diffusion characteristics of Botox, Dysport, and Xeomin helps tailor injectable cosmetics to specific areas. Botox's precision might be preferred for minor, localized treatments, while Dysport's broader diffusion may be optimal for more significant facial regions like the forehead.


Onset and Duration of Results

Considering the speed of action and longevity of effects among these neurotoxins is crucial. With its quicker onset, Dysport may be preferable for those seeking rapid visible results. At the same time, Xeomin, known for its longer duration in some cases, might suit individuals aiming for prolonged effects.


Allergies and Sensitivities

For individuals with known allergies or sensitivities, the formulation purity of Xeomin might be the deciding factor due to its reduced likelihood of causing allergic reactions or developing antibodies, making it a safer option for these individuals.
